Thousands of jobs in line for business park

DEVELOPERS are hoping to create up to 2,400 jobs at a Stafford business park, it has been revealed.

Now, bosses have unveiled plans to attract new factories, offices, a hotel and pub to the 50 acre site - creating a recruitment boom for the local area over the next five years.

It comes just weeks after MOD Stafford announced 1,200 troops will be re-locating to the nearby Beacon Barracks in 2015 - bringing-in scores of potential customers.

ISE bought the land from the Ministry Defence in 2005 and has since signed deals with 12 businesses - creating 350 jobs. However, they still have to win full planning permission from Stafford Borough Council before going ahead with any expansion.

Andrew Bramall, one of the owners of ISE Estates, said: "In these difficult times, approval for this development will benefit the area immediately, demonstrating that Stafford is a place business can come and grow." With more than 20,000 sq ft of warehouses, the business park has been almost fully occupied throughout the recent economic downturn with owners turning away offers from interested businesses.

Mr Bramall added: "With such a central location, good infrastructure and excellent security, we are confident that we can continue to attract high calibre companies and jobs to Stafford." The announcement comes after Asda Living, M&S and Morrisons announced their intention to open new stores around Stafford town centre during the last few weeks.
